Based on 101 recent sales, the median property price is £225,000 (about £249 per square foot) in Wellswood area, with individual transactions ranging from £82,000 up to £1,175,000.
| Type | Sales | Median | £/sq ft |
|---|---|---|---|
| Detached | 23 | £718,000 | £353 |
| Semi-Detached | 4 | £287,500 | £293 |
| Terraced | 14 | £237,500 | £277 |
| Flats | 60 | £160,000 | £232 |

Postcode TQ1 2EH is located in an urban city, within the Wellswood ward of Torbay in the South West region, and forms part of the Wellswood area. It has average deprivation and high crime levels, with around 66.7 crimes per 1,000 residents per year, about 22% below the South West average of 85 per 1,000. The average income per household in Wellswood is £39,267 per year. The nearest station is Torquay, about 1.4 miles away. There are 2 primary and no secondary schools in the area. There are 2 parks nearby, the closest medium park is Daddyhole Plain.
